elleluv Posted April 20, 2007 #2 Share Posted April 20, 2007 We've used Budget in the past... www.budget.com It has worked out very well. A rental car is definitely the least expensive method to get to Port Canaveral. Budget has an office very close to Port Canaveral with a shuttle to/from the Port. Since there are 4 of you, I would suggest driving the car to the port and dropping off the luggage and everyone but the driver of the car before returning it. Cavatelli430 Posted April 20, 2007 #8 Share Posted April 20, 2007 We used Thrifty car rental each way. They have an office right by Port Canaveral and shuttle to ship. Coming back very easy too, just got on shuttle back to Thrifty and got another car back to Orlando. Office in Orlando is right off airport property, but shuttle is provided and service was quick. We were in our car within 15 mins! I've had problems with Budget in the past, their desk is inside airport and had a long wait in line, almost 2 hrs to get car that we already had a reservation for.
